    Anatomy and Function of the Pelvic Floor

    Anatomical Structure of the Pelvic Floor Muscles

    The pelvic floor comprises a group of muscles and connective tissues supporting the pelvic organs. These muscles span the area between the pubic bone and the tailbone, forming a supportive hammock.

    Role in Stability, Posture, and Movement

    Pelvic floor muscles contribute to spinal stability, help maintain proper posture, and facilitate movement coordination—elements crucial for effective riding technique.

    Connection to Inner Core and Overall Riding Performance

    As part of the inner core, the pelvic floor interacts with abdominal, back, and hip muscles, forming a dynamic system that enhances rider control and endurance.

    The Rise of Pelvic Floor Trainers

    Definition and Purpose of Pelvic Floor Training Devices

    Pelvic floor trainers are innovative devices designed to strengthen, stretch, or activate pelvic muscles through biofeedback, electrical stimulation, or mechanical resistance, tailored to each rider's needs.

    Types of Pelvic Floor Trainers Available

    • Biofeedback devices that monitor muscle activity and encourage proper engagement
    • Electrical stimulation units to activate dormant muscles
    • Mechanical trainers offering resistance for strengthening exercises
